Implement read_settings function to get configuration for automatic
contexts. Fix the issue uncovered by added support for automatic
context activation: do not use AT+CGACT for the contexts handled
by AT^SWWAN. As per modem specs, CGACT context can not be reused
for SWWAN. Though that worked for some reason when automatic
context was reactivated without proper deactivation.
